Sports Coverage and Markets

One of Melbet’s strongest selling points is the breadth of sports and betting markets. You’ll find mainstream Canadian favourites — such as NHL, CFL, soccer, and tennis — alongside obscure events like futsal, e-sports tournaments and regional racing series. The platform often lists hundreds of markets for major fixtures, including handicaps, totals, corner bets, player props and special markets.

Payments and Banking for Canadian Customers

Melbet supports a broad range of payment methods: e-wallets, cryptocurrencies, bank cards and regional bank transfers. Processing times vary — e-wallets and crypto are typically fastest for withdrawals, while card and bank transfers can take several business days. Canadians should confirm whether their preferred method is accepted and whether currency conversion fees apply when using CAD or another currency.
